Christian Service University College Ghana: A Comprehensive Overview of Courses and Programs

Christian Service University College (CSUC) is a private, non-profit institution located in Kumasi, Ghana. Founded in 1974, CSUC is officially recognized by the Ghana Tertiary Education Commission and affiliated with the Christian-Evangelical religion. The university is committed to fostering professionalism, excellence, and competence in its students.

Academic Programs and Schools

Ghana Christian University College offers a range of academic programs across four schools and ten academic departments. The university has a strong reputation for providing high-quality education in various fields, including Theology, Management, Nursing, Technology, and the Arts.

The University College now runs postgraduate and undergraduate programmes including:

  • Master of Arts in Christian Ministry with Management
  • Bachelor of Arts in Theology (with Administration)
  • Bachelor of Business Administration
  • Bachelor of Science in Computer Science
  • Bachelor of Arts in Communication Studies
  • Bachelor of Science in Nursing
  • Bachelor of Arts in Community Development

Tuition and Fees

The academic calendar at CSUC is divided into two semesters. For convenience, tuition fees are calculated per year. One year of studying at CSUC will cost local citizens a minimum of 64 USD. For foreigners, the tuition fee is different - from 2,500 USD per year.

When choosing an educational institution, it is necessary to take into account additional costs: accommodation, transportation, educational materials, meals and personal expenses.

Social Responsibilities and Community Engagement

As a Christian institution of higher education, CSUC continues to promote spiritual and moral values and extends support to the vulnerable in society. The Department of Theology of CSUC in June every year undertakes evangelical outreaches to churches in remote communities across Ghana to share the Word of God, reach out and inspire the vulnerable, offer counseling services and engage in community services like clean-up exercises to promote sanitation, raise awareness and create community responsibility.

As part of its corporate social responsibilities and youth empowerment programme, CSUC has established a scholarship scheme for indigenes of Odeneho Kwadaso, a suburb of Kumasi where the University College is situated. As part of the social responsibilities also, the CSUC in May 2013 donated refurbished bunk beds and mattresses to the Rullman Methodist Vocational Technical Institute at Juaben in the Ashanti Region to support the institute.

CSUC has set up a Centre for Leadership and Professional Development (CLPD) primarily aimed at promoting leadership training and capacity building, professional development, and quality teaching and learning at the University College, the corporate business world and the society in general.
